Effect of Omega 3 Supplementation on the Heart Rate Variability in Obese Children, a Clinical Trial

Evidence shows that omega-3 fatty acids lower blood triglyceride levels, lower blood pressure, enhance insulin sensitivity, and improve heart rate variability (HRV) measures, all of which may be indicators of cardiovascular health.As a result, omega-3 fatty acid supplementation may be a low-cost strategy with little adverse effects for obese youngsters, perhaps delaying the development of chronic cardiovascular illnesses.

Description

Inclusion Criteria:

  • Children (5-12 years) whose parents or caregivers will agree to be enrolled in the study
  • Obese Children (Simple obesity )
  • Both males and females

Exclusion Criteria:

  • Patients are known to have cardiac disease
  • Patients with associated chronic systemic illness
  • Patients with 2ry obesity : (endocrine /metabolic/genetics/drug intake)
  • Patients on medications affecting heart rate :structural or arrhythmic

Arms and Interventions

Participant Group / Arm
Intervention / Treatment
Experimental: Interventional group recieveing omega 3 and the standard nutritional regimen for 3 months
The intervention group will be examined by 10 -minutes Holter and then omega 3 will be given to children( at least 400 mg eicosapentaenoic acid (EPA) and 120 mg docosahexaenoic acid (DHA) daily in addition to the standard nutritional regimen ) daily for 3 months and then reassesent of Holter will be carried out .
The interventional group will be given omega 3 for 3 months
Placebo Comparator: Control group receiving placebo and the standard nutritional regimen for 3 months
The control group will be examined by 10 -minutes Holter and then the standard nutritional regimen will be given daily for 3 months and then reassessment of Holter will be carried out .
The control group will be given placebo for 3 months
